Rakell

A double-l variant of Rakel, this spelling adds visual weight and a softer phonetic emphasis to the Scandinavian form of Rachel. The doubled consonant creates a distinctly modern twist on a classic name, popular in contemporary Nordic naming.

Rakell is a girl's name of Hebrew origin. A double-l variant of Rakel, this spelling adds visual weight and a softer phonetic emphasis to the Scandinavian form of Rachel. The doubled consonant creates a distinctly modern twist on a classic name, popular in contemporary Nordic naming.

A modern spelling variation reflecting contemporary Scandinavian preferences for visual and phonetic variation.
